1

XML::Twig Perl モジュールを使用して HTML ドキュメントから div を抽出し、この div と必要な HTML ラッピングのみを含む新しい HTML ドキュメントを作成したいと考えています。次に、いくつかの CSS スタイルを新しいドキュメントに追加します。

div を抽出するのは簡単ですが、自分で HTML ラッピングを書くのが面倒です :-)。

そんな退屈な部分をやってくれる Perl モジュールがきっとあるはずです。それとも、XML::Twig 自体のメソッドでさえ、私が見落としたり、理解できなかったりするのでしょうか?

4

1 に答える 1

2

divを使用して (非常に!) 最小限の HTML 小枝を作成しmy $html= XML::Twig->new->parse_html( '')、そこに貼り付けることができるはずです。ただし、空の文字列をもう少し HTML っぽいものに置き換えたり、CSS を含むより優れた HTML テンプレートをロードしたりすることもできます。

于 2013-05-29T16:05:11.273 に答える